AHAs and BHAs AHAs (alpha hydroxy acids) and BHAs (beta hydroxy acids) are exfoliating ingredients that are used to improve the appearance of the skin. AHAs work by dissolving the bonds that hold dead skin cells together, while BHAs penetrate deeper into the pores to remove sebum and other impurities.

When you undergo microdermabrasion, the exfoliation process removes the outermost layer of your skin, which consists of dead skin cells, dirt, and other impurities. By eliminating this layer, microdermabrasion helps to improve the overall texture and appearance of your skin. How Does Microdermabrasion Affect Your Skin?
During the microdermabrasion treatment, the handheld device emits tiny crystals or a diamond-tipped wand that gently exfoliates the skin. This exfoliation process removes the dead skin cells and unclogs the pores, allowing the skin to breathe and absorb skincare products more effectively.
